Atiku promises completion of federal projects in Jigawa

January 22, 2019
BY DAHIRU  SULEIMAN, DUTSE.
Former Vice President, and  presidential candidate of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) Alhaji Atiku Abubakar has promised Jigawa populace of completion of abandoned federal projects initiated by last PDP government.
Speaking while canvassing for votes  at a mammoth rally in Dutse on Monday, he listed the projects as Hadejia – Jemaare river valley erosion, rehabilitation of the Gaya-Jahun-Hadejia federal road, and Kwanar Dumawa-Kano- Babura federal roads.
According to Atiku this was imperative, since the PDP believes  in infrastructural development.
Abubakar  expressed delight over the  warm reception accorded him by members of his party and the people of the state during his campaign trip to Jigawa.
“Basically, with what I saw practically, I have the believe that our party, the PDP will soon captured the country,” he said.
He assured PDP faithfuls of a balanced and transparent government that will ensure equity and just among govern and the governed.
” I Atiku Abubakar, I promise to offer myself to Nigerians in floating a purposeful leadership that will cater for all and sundry, devoid of tribal nor sectionalism only for the overall developments of our great country, if elected next president of this country”.
Also speaking, the PDP National Chairman, Chief Uche Secondus  warned the Independent National Independent Commission ( INEC) and it’s
officials to eschew rigging.
 ” I am sounding a fierce warning to officials of the country’s Electoral body to distant itself from any move to rigging and manipulations in the conduct of the 2019 forth-coming general elections”, said Secondus.
